His work is characterized by lucid prose, social criticism, and opposition to totalitarianism. Best known for his allegorical novella Animal Farm and the dystopian masterpiece 1984, he remains one of the most influential writers of the 20th century. His experiences in colonial Burma and the Spanish Civil War deeply informed his political perspectives and his commitment to democratic socialism, leaving an indelible mark on modern literature.\u003c\/p\u003e","brand":"Fingerprint","offers":[{"title":"Default Title","offer_id":47810735407357,"sku":null,"price":318.0,"currency_code":"NPR","in_stock":true}],"thumbnail_url":"\/\/cdn.shopify.com\/s\/files\/1\/0484\/4145\/8840\/files\/81fcLJo_FNL._SL2000.jpg?v=1783535823","url":"https:\/\/biblionepal.com\/products\/1984-3","provider":"BIBLIONEPAL","version":"1.0","type":"link"}
